WORCESTER – Bertha M. (Askervitch) Dillon, 103, of Worcester, died Saturday, September 17, 2016, at home surrounded by her family.
Her husband of 37 years, John Dillon, died in 1974. She leaves a sister, Nell Forsberg of Worcester; several nephews and nieces, including Peter Askervitch and his significant other Debbie of Charlton, Ann St. Germaine and her husband Edward of Worcester, Dorothy Forsberg and her significant other Obdulio Rodriguez of Worcester, Judy Santella and her husband Steve of Oxford; a grandson Sean and granddaughter Robin. She is predeceased by her son Michael Dillon and his wife Kathy Dillon, a sister Ann Askervitch, her brothers William, Joseph and Peter Askervitch, and a brother-in-law, Chester Forsberg. She was born in Worcester, daughter of Michael and Agatha (Pozuta) Askervitch.
Bertha was able to live in her own home with family assistance until her death at age 103. She was a strong, fiercely independent woman until the end.
